在企业信息化和数字化的过程中,业务架构和应用架构的优先级选择是一个关键决策。本文将从基本概念、适用场景、潜在问题及解决方案等方面,探讨业务架构优先和应用架构优先的优劣,并结合行业案例,帮助企业在不同场景下做出更明智的选择。
1. 业务架构与应用架构的基本概念
1.1 业务架构
业务架构是企业为实现其战略目标而设计的业务模型和流程框架。它关注的是企业的核心业务逻辑、业务流程、组织结构和资源分配。简单来说,业务架构回答的是“企业做什么”和“如何做”的问题。
1.2 应用架构
应用架构则是支撑业务架构的技术实现框架,包括软件系统、数据流、接口设计等。它关注的是如何通过技术手段实现业务需求,回答的是“用什么技术做”和“如何高效做”的问题。
2. 业务架构优先的适用场景及优势
2.1 适用场景
- 战略转型期:当企业需要进行大规模业务模式调整或战略转型时,业务架构优先可以帮助企业明确新的业务方向和流程。
- 复杂业务流程:对于业务流程复杂、涉及多个部门协作的企业,业务架构优先可以确保流程的清晰性和一致性。
- 创新驱动型企业:以创新为核心竞争力的企业,业务架构优先有助于快速响应市场变化和客户需求。
2.2 优势
- 战略对齐:业务架构优先确保技术投入与业务目标高度一致,避免资源浪费。
- 流程优化:通过业务架构的梳理,可以发现并优化低效流程,提升整体运营效率。
- 灵活性:业务架构优先的企业在面对市场变化时,能够更快调整业务模式,保持竞争优势。
3. 应用架构优先的适用场景及优势
3.1 适用场景
- 技术驱动型企业:以技术创新为核心的企业,应用架构优先可以快速实现技术突破,推动业务发展。
- 已有成熟业务模式:对于业务模式相对稳定、流程成熟的企业,应用架构优先可以提升技术效率和系统稳定性。
- 快速迭代需求:在需要快速推出新产品或服务的行业,应用架构优先可以缩短开发周期,提高市场响应速度。
3.2 优势
- 技术少有:应用架构优先有助于企业在技术上保持少有地位,提升竞争力。
- 系统稳定性:通过优化应用架构,可以提高系统的稳定性和可维护性,减少故障率。
- 开发效率:应用架构优先可以简化开发流程,提高开发效率,缩短产品上市时间。
4. 业务架构优先可能遇到的问题及解决方案
4.1 问题
- 技术实现难度大:业务架构优先可能导致技术实现复杂,增加开发难度。
- 资源分配不均:过度关注业务架构可能导致技术资源分配不足,影响系统性能。
- 变革阻力:业务架构调整可能涉及组织变革,面临内部阻力。
4.2 解决方案
- 技术评估:在业务架构设计阶段,进行技术可行性评估,确保技术实现的可行性。
- 资源平衡:合理分配业务和技术资源,确保两者协调发展。
- 变革管理:通过有效的变革管理,减少内部阻力,推动业务架构顺利实施。
5. 应用架构优先可能遇到的问题及解决方案
5.1 问题
- 业务需求不明确:应用架构优先可能导致业务需求不明确,影响系统设计的合理性。
- 技术债务:过度关注技术实现可能导致技术债务积累,影响系统长期发展。
- 业务与技术脱节:应用架构优先可能导致业务与技术脱节,影响整体战略对齐。
5.2 解决方案
- 需求调研:在应用架构设计前,进行充分的业务需求调研,确保系统设计符合业务需求。
- 技术债务管理:通过定期技术债务评估和管理,减少技术债务对系统的影响。
- 业务与技术协同:建立业务与技术协同机制,确保两者紧密配合,共同推动企业发展。
6. 不同行业对架构优先级的选择案例
6.1 金融行业
- 业务架构优先:金融行业业务流程复杂,监管要求严格,业务架构优先有助于确保合规性和流程优化。
- 案例:某银行在数字化转型中,优先梳理业务架构,优化业务流程,提升客户体验。
6.2 科技行业
- 应用架构优先:科技行业技术更新快,应用架构优先有助于快速实现技术突破,推动业务发展。
- 案例:某科技公司在产品开发中,优先优化应用架构,缩短开发周期,提高市场响应速度。
6.3 零售行业
- 业务架构优先:零售行业市场竞争激烈,业务架构优先有助于快速响应市场变化,提升竞争力。
- 案例:某零售企业在数字化转型中,优先调整业务架构,优化供应链管理,提升运营效率。
总结:业务架构优先和应用架构优先各有优劣,选择哪种策略取决于企业的具体需求和行业特点。业务架构优先适用于战略转型、复杂业务流程和创新驱动型企业,而应用架构优先则更适合技术驱动、业务模式成熟和快速迭代需求的企业。在实际操作中,企业应根据自身情况,灵活选择并平衡两者,以实现挺好的业务和技术协同效果。
原创文章,作者:hiIT,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_strategy/280865